Lord of the Dance: Dangerous Games Moves to Playhouse Theatre From October

Michael Flatley’s Lord of the Dance: Dangerous Games  has found a new home for London audiences to enjoy it has been announced.

The production will make a return to London with performances at the Playhouse Theatre from the 10th October, following its hugely successful six month run at the Dominion Theatre, which finished earlier this month.

Talking about the production’s return to the West End, Michael Flatley said: “I’m delighted that London has once again welcomed us so warmly, and to be able to extend the show’s run by moving to the very beautiful Playhouse Theatre makes me feel immensely proud of what we’ve achieved.  I am delighted for my dancers that they can continue to perform in this great city.”

The cast at the Playhouse Theatre will be led by Flatley’s young stars Morgan Comer and James Keegan – who have both won every major title in Irish competitive dancing. They were trained by Flatley and have featured in the West End and touring productions of Dangerous Games.

Dangerous Games features exciting and ground-breaking technology which includes holographs, special effects lighting, dancing robots, champion acrobats and a great team of Irish dancers.

Tickets are on sale now and prices range from £15 (standing) to £90 premium.

Lord of the Dance: Dangerous Games is at the Playhouse Theatre from the 10th October to the 3rd January.
